在sql server 中怎么查询哪个用户在什么时间用SA帐号登陆到数据库的

如题所述

有三种方式:
1.
开始--》管理工具--》事件查看器--》事件查看器(本地)--》应用程序
双击一个事件可以查看详细信息。
2.
登陆SQL Server Management Studio,在‘’对象资源管理器‘’中,屏开‘’实例名‘’--》‘’管理‘’--》‘’SQL Server日志‘’。双击某一个日志存档,打开‘’日志文件查看器‘’窗口,可以查看日志的具体内容。
3.
使用”登录触发器“,可以参考CSDN网站,有详解。
http://msdn.microsoft.com/zh-cn/library/bb326598.aspx
温馨提示:答案为网友推荐,仅供参考
第1个回答  2011-12-29
你可以在服务器的安全日志里面看到,所有用户的登陆履历
第2个回答  2011-12-29
查看日志
相似回答